Changing the Screen Displayed after Shots

Change the way images are displayed after shots as follows.
1
Set [Display Time] to [2 sec.],
[4 sec.], [8 sec.], or [Hold] (= 56).
2
Configure the setting.
Choose [Display Info], and then choose
z
the desired option.
To restore the original setting, repeat this
z
process but choose [Off].
Off
Displays only the image.
Detailed
Displays shooting details ( = 192).
When [Display Time] ( = 56) is set to [Off] or [Quick], [Display
Info] is set to [Off] and cannot be changed.
